and wat is rt, r/t, watever people called it. people have written threads about it and i dont know wat it is
kada0278
09-11-2005, 09:16 PM
The rt is a response trigger. it makes your rate of fire increase. The ones for a 98c take it from 5bps to 15bps. I don't know what the specs for an a-5 are, though.
As for the gun question: A-5 because not only are they reliable, but the cyclone force feed that comes standard is the same concept that is in a HaloB hopper ($100 upgrade). And as an added bonus it runs off of air so you don't have to worry about batteries going dead. And you should never chop a ball.

Oh yeah response is much faster.
I'll have to disagree with you here, a stock A-5 can be shot really fast. The E-Grip will of course yield higher rates of fire on turbo (If it's what I'm thinking of that is) but the Response just makes it easier to hit high rates of fire. A friend of mine has an A-5 with an Evil Pipe, 32 degrees X-Chamber and a 5" drop. He recently took off his response because most places around here are starting to make people turn off their responses, and he was getting accused of using his response by other players when he was actually just hammering the stock trigger really fast with his middle finger.
Just yesterday I played against him and I think he's shooting his A-5 faster stock then it fired when he had the response on it.
Back on track though. . .
I say get an A-5 because when you buy an A-5 it comes with a solid hopper which will handle the higher rates of fire. And I would suggest saving up a little for a decent barrel next and then either a X-chamber or a reg (if you intend to change your gas source at some point.) And a drop wouldn't hurt at some point either.
